c++string 从一个英文句子中提取出英文单词
在 C 语言中,可以使用字符串函数 strtok() 来从一个英文句子中提取出英文单词。使用方法如下:首先,包含要处理的字符串的字符数组应该被声明。然后,调用 strtok() 函数,并将要处理的字符串和分隔符作为参数传递给它。strtok() 函数会在字符串中搜索分隔符,并将字符串分割为一个个英文单词。可以通过多次调用 strtok() 函数来遍历字符串中的所有英文单词。...
·
在 C 语言中,可以使用字符串函数 strtok()
来从一个英文句子中提取出英文单词。
使用方法如下:
-
首先,包含要处理的字符串的字符数组应该被声明。
-
然后,调用
strtok()
函数,并将要处理的字符串和分隔符作为参数传递给它。 -
strtok()
函数会在字符串中搜索分隔符,并将字符串分割为一个个英文单词。 -
可以通过多次调用
strtok()
函数来遍历字符串中的所有英文单词。
下面是一个简单的例子,展示了如何使用 strtok()
函数提取英文单词:
#include <stdio.h>
#include <string.h>
int main()
{
char str[] = "This is a test sentence.";
char *token;
/* get the first token */
token = strtok(str, " ");
/* walk through other tokens */
while( token != NULL ) {
printf( " %s\n", token );
token = strtok(NULL, " ");
}
return 0;
}
更多推荐
所有评论(0)